Ubersuggest is generally better when you need SEO-specific data such as keyword metrics, keyword difficulty, competitor analysis, site audits, backlinks, and rank tracking, while free AI SEO tools are more useful for brainstorming keywords, creating content ideas, analyzing search intent, and organizing an SEO strategy. Ubersuggest currently combines keyword research, competitor analysis, site auditing, backlink information, rank tracking and AI-assisted keyword research in one platform.
For most bloggers and small websites, the strongest approach is not choosing one exclusively: use AI tools for research and ideation, then use Ubersuggest or another dedicated SEO platform to validate important keyword and competition data.
The difference matters because an AI chatbot can generate a convincing list of keywords without knowing whether those keywords have meaningful search demand or how competitive the current search results are.
Ubersuggest, by comparison, is designed specifically around SEO research and provides data-based metrics that can be used to evaluate keyword opportunities.
What Is Ubersuggest?
Ubersuggest is an SEO platform developed by Neil Patel that provides tools for keyword research, competitor analysis, site auditing, backlink research, rank tracking and content-related SEO work.
The platform is designed to help website owners discover keywords, understand competitors and identify SEO opportunities from a single dashboard.
Ubersuggest also offers AI-assisted keyword research features, including AI-generated keyword ideas alongside search volume, search intent and difficulty information.
The platform currently describes its keyword research system as using a large keyword database and combining AI-generated suggestions with SEO data.
Ubersuggest also provides a free account with lower limits compared with its paid access, according to its current official information.
What Are Free AI SEO Tools?
Free AI SEO tools are AI-powered applications that help with tasks such as keyword brainstorming, search-intent analysis, content outlines, title generation, topic clustering, content optimization and SEO planning.
Examples include general-purpose AI assistants and specialized AI-powered SEO tools.
The biggest advantage is flexibility.
You can ask an AI tool questions such as:
“Give me 50 long-tail keyword ideas for a technology blog.”
Or:
“Group these keywords by search intent.”
Or:
“Create a content cluster around AI image generators.”
However, AI-generated suggestions should not automatically be treated as verified keyword data.
An AI assistant can suggest a keyword that sounds highly relevant but may have little search demand or may not represent the search behavior you expect.
That is the biggest difference between AI-generated SEO ideas and SEO data platforms.

Why Keyword Data Matters
Imagine an AI chatbot gives you these ideas:
- AI tools for bloggers
- Best AI tools for bloggers
- Free AI tools for bloggers
- AI tools for small blogs
- AI SEO tools for bloggers
All five sound reasonable.
But you still need to know:
- Does the query have search demand?
- How competitive is it?
- What pages currently rank?
- What is the search intent?
- Is the keyword relevant to your audience?
- Can your website realistically compete?
An SEO platform can provide data that helps answer these questions.
This is where Ubersuggest has an advantage over a general free AI chatbot.

Ubersuggest vs AI for Search Intent
Search intent is an area where both approaches can be useful.
Search intent refers to what a person actually wants when entering a query into a search engine.
Common types include:
Informational Intent
The user wants an answer or explanation.
Example:
“What is an AI SEO tool?”
Commercial Investigation
The user is comparing options.
Example:
“Ubersuggest vs Semrush”
Transactional Intent
The user is ready to take an action.
Example:
“Ubersuggest pricing”
Navigational Intent
The user is looking for a particular website or service.
Example:
“Ubersuggest login”
AI is particularly useful for classifying large keyword lists into these categories.
Ubersuggest can complement that process with keyword and SERP-related data.
The best approach is to combine both.
Ubersuggest vs Free AI Tools for Competitor Analysis
This is another major difference.
Ubersuggest is designed to analyze competitors and provides competitive SEO information as part of its platform. Its current product information lists competitor analysis, traffic estimates, top-performing content, SERP analysis and backlink opportunities among its competitive-intelligence capabilities.
A general-purpose AI chatbot does not automatically have access to the same SEO database.
You can ask AI:
“Analyze this competitor’s SEO strategy.”
But the answer depends heavily on what data you provide or what external tools the AI can access.
That means AI can be an excellent analysis layer, but it is not necessarily the source of the underlying SEO data.

Which Is Better for Finding Low-Competition Keywords?
If your main objective is finding potentially lower-competition keywords, Ubersuggest has the stronger role because it provides SEO-specific keyword data and difficulty information.
AI is better at generating possibilities.
Ubersuggest is better suited to validating those possibilities.
For example:
AI idea:
“free AI keyword research tools for new bloggers”
Ubersuggest research:
Check available search volume, difficulty, related terms and competing results.
Final decision:
Manually inspect Google and determine whether the search results provide a realistic content opportunity.
This three-stage approach is much stronger than relying on an AI-generated keyword list alone.

Use Both if You Want a Complete Workflow
For serious blogging, the strongest approach is:
1. Use AI to brainstorm.
Generate dozens of topic and keyword ideas.
2. Use Ubersuggest to validate.
Check available keyword data and competition indicators.
3. Check Google manually.
Look at the actual search results.
4. Create better content.
Answer the searcher’s question more completely than competing pages.
5. Improve the article over time.
Monitor performance and update information when necessary.
This approach avoids relying on either AI assumptions or a single SEO metric.
